xlwings返回有多少个工作表
时间: 2023-08-11 22:08:45 浏览: 111
xlwings是Python针对Excel的一个库,可以用来操作Excel工作簿和工作表。如果要返回有多少个工作表,可以使用Workbook对象的sheets属性来获取所有的工作表,然后使用len函数来获取工作表的数量。以下是示例代码:
```python
import xlwings as xw
# 打开Excel文件
wb = xw.Book('example.xlsx')
# 获取所有的工作表
sheets = wb.sheets
# 获取工作表数量
num_of_sheets = len(sheets)
print('工作表数量:', num_of_sheets)
```
注意,xlwings需要安装并配置好Excel才能正常使用。
相关问题
xlwings 返回列号
xlwings 提供了一些方便的方法来获取单元格的行号和列号。如果您想要获取单元格的列号,可以使用 `column` 属性,例如:
```python
import xlwings as xw
# 打开工作簿和工作表
wb = xw.Book('workbook.xlsx')
ws = wb.sheets['Sheet1']
# 获取 A1 单元格的列号
column_number = ws.range('A1').column
print(column_number) # 输出 1
```
如果您想要在给定的工作表中搜索某个指定的列名,您可以使用 `api` 属性来访问 Excel 的 API,并使用 `Match` 方法查找匹配的列名,然后返回该列的列号。例如:
```python
import xlwings as xw
# 打开工作簿和工作表
wb = xw.Book('workbook.xlsx')
ws = wb.sheets['Sheet1']
# 搜索 'Column B' 并返回列号
column_name = 'Column B'
api = wb.app.api
column_number = api.Match(column_name, ws.range('1:1').value[0], 0)
print(column_number) # 输出 2
```
请注意,Excel 中的列号从 1 开始,因此第一列的列号为 1,第二列的列号为 2,以此类推。
xlwings有哪些常用函数?
xlwings是一款用于连接Python和Excel的库,它提供了一系列的函数来操作Excel,常用的一些函数包括:
1. Range函数:用于选择Excel表格中的一个区域,并返回一个Range对象,可以用来读取或者写入数据。
2. Book函数:用于选择一个Excel工作簿,并返回一个Book对象,可以用来打开、关闭、保存工作簿等操作。
3. Sheet函数:用于选择Excel工作簿中的一个工作表,并返回一个Sheet对象,可以用来读取或者写入工作表中的数据。
4. View函数:用于设置Excel的视图模式,包括冻结窗格、隐藏行列等操作。
5. Picture函数:用于在Excel中插入图片,并返回一个Picture对象,可以用来设置图片的位置、大小等属性。
6. Chart函数:用于在Excel中创建图表,并返回一个Chart对象,可以用来设置图表的类型、标题、数据等属性。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)